Well, the Tanya Huff book "Smoke and Shadows" was where I got the idea of shadow possession, and that played so well into the next step for the Shadow Queen. And Universo Project was one of my favorite LSH arcs, and there was definitely an influence from that on this story. I've always enjoyed the "friend against friend" stories. And with this, it wasn't so much who was more powerful as who knows more about their adversary. While Crujectra is weaker than Ultra Matt, for instance, knowing how his powers work enabled her to work out a way to slow him down.

It was really a fun story to write, but I did feel at times that it was too dialogue heavy, and I felt that I should somehow be adding more description into the scenes to give a better idea of what was going on. I did use dialogue to do that to some extent, but I was afraid that the story would grow too large if I started getting too descriptive.

And I try to make everyone powerful in their own way, but at the same time set limits to keep them in check. Maxx has the potential to be an extremely powerful character, but I purposefully limited him so that he would still be managable, like in having him not be able to Gate to just anywhere he wanted in the galaxy. Same with Crujectra and Crusader. Sure, they can use their poweres to fly, so long as the have something to use their powers against to keep them aloft. You'll never see the twins flying through space under their own power, because I choose to give them realistic limits on how their powers work.

It definitely keeps it fun to write that way [Smile]
